Transaction 31e7afff75a617b4f3b4633a9bb2998f5e0e92962e9eef0bcafbab579424608f
1 Input
2 Outputs
- 31e7afff75a617b4f3b4633a9bb2998f5e0e92962e9eef0bcafbab579424608f:0
- 31e7afff75a617b4f3b4633a9bb2998f5e0e92962e9eef0bcafbab579424608f:1
value 17381091
address 3MGFzEyCfJswtT59rcqfQdSAu6toQe7W2M
value 467405638
address 3HvcYRSueZS9ogZhp6LKDyajDTuUxnEbiH